What should be included in the project brief when hiring a freelance video editor on Contra?
The project brief should include the project's scope, timeline, and specific goals you want to achieve. Clearly define the deliverables, such as the format and length of the final video, any brand guidelines to follow, and style references if applicable. Including this information will help the freelancer understand your needs and expectations before starting the project.
How can I ensure the freelance video editor understands the project's creative vision on Contra?
To ensure the video editor understands your creative vision, schedule a kick-off meeting to discuss the project in detail. Share visual examples, mood boards, or references that capture the desired style and tone of the video. Engage in an open dialogue, allowing the freelancer to ask questions and provide input to align on the creative direction.
What are effective ways to set up a workflow for smooth communication and updates with a freelance video editor on Contra?
Establish clear communication channels, whether it's through Contra's platform, email, or a project management tool. Set up regular check-ins or milestones to review progress and provide feedback. Specify preferred times for updates and ensure that both parties have access to necessary assets and resources from the project's start.
